When an Android device undergoes a hard factory reset without the owner first logging out of their registered Google account, Android's built-in security protocol triggers a lockout. The phrase highlights the trendiest, most successful methods and files currently utilized by the Global System for Mobile Communications (GSM) community to bypass this security layer on modern smartphones. Understanding the Mechanics of Android FRP

FRP is getting harder to crack. With Android 12, 13, and 14, Google patched old vulnerabilities like using the TalkBack or Google Assistant loopholes. Today, the “hot” methods involve:

: A premium, widely respected software among GSM technicians. It supports a massive array of chipsets (MediaTek, Qualcomm, Unisoc) and can clear FRP locks in one click by putting the phone into Brom or EDL mode.

FRP is enabled by default on devices running Android 5.1 (Lollipop) and higher as soon as a Google account is added.
